New Delhi: A book by senior Congress leader and former Union Minister Salman Khurshid was released on Wednesday. From what he has said about Hindutva in this book, a big controversy has arisen. In this book, Khurshid compares Hindutva with the terrorist organizations Boko Haram and ISIS. BJP has expressed anger over this. BJP has said that this has hurt not only Hindus but also the soul of India.

Complaint against Khurshid to Delhi Police
A complaint has been lodged with the Delhi Police against Salman Khurshid. He has been accused of trying to discredit Hindutva by comparing it with terrorism. The complaint was lodged against Khurshid’s book Sunrise on Ayodhya Nationhood in Our Times. A Delhi-based lawyer by the name of Vivek Garg has lodged a complaint with the Delhi Police Commissioner seeking registration of a case.
